Hybrid systems currently account for approximately 20 percent of the rooftop solar market in India and are expected to grow further. The successful deployment of over 2.87 GW of hybrid projects with battery storage further underscores the sector's untapped potential.
-
The solar energy landscape in India is undergoing a rapid change, with hybrid and off-grid systems gaining traction due to rising electricity costs, the need for reliable power in rural and semi-urban areas and a strong national push toward sustainable, decentralised energy. These systems offer a dependable alternative where grid access is limited or inconsistent. Panasonic Life Solutions India is actively expanding its solar technology portfolio in response to this growing demand. The company is gearing up to launch advanced hybrid solar solutions tailored to the country's unique energy landscape. These systems are designed to ensure energy resilience, offering efficient, uninterrupted power supply while supporting the nation's green energy ambitions. The initiative by Panasonic reflects its commitment to shaping a future-ready, self-reliant energy ecosystem across diverse regions in India.
